Can GeForce GTX 1060 run Blast?
GreatThe GeForce GTX 1060 handles Blast well at 1080p, delivering approximately 789 FPS at High settings — above the 60 FPS target for smooth gameplay. It can also achieve smooth 1440p at around 591 FPS.
Blast – GeForce GTX 1060 FPS Data
| Quality | 1080p | 1440p | 4K |
|---|---|---|---|
| Low | 999+ fps | 924 fps | 493 fps |
| Medium | 986 fps | 739 fps | 394 fps |
| High | 789 fps | 591 fps | 315 fps |
| Ultra | 641 fps | 481 fps | 256 fps |
Estimated FPS · actual performance may vary based on drivers and settings
